Day 4 | Onwards to the Canals of Venice

Journey through the emerald-green landscape along

the Brenner Pass into Italy and across the Dolomite

Mountains to Venice. We cruise the beautiful Venetian

lagoon by private launch to the gateway of Venice, St.

Mark’s Square. View the ornate Doge’s Palace and the

Bridge of Sighs, so named for the sound made by

condemned prisoners as they took one last longing

look at their beautiful city before meeting their fate.

Enjoy a MAKE TRAVEL MATTER Experience where

you’ll witness the centuries-old craft of Venetian

glassblowing. You’ll learn how the master craftsmen

shape the molten glass to make the exquisite and

delicate works of art that adorn homes all over the

world and perhaps be inspired to buy your own

souvenir as a reminder of this special visit. There’s time

later to enjoy the city your way. Get lost in Venice,

cross bridges and discover hidden campi where locals

share their daily stories over a glass of Venetian Spritz.

Overnight Stay at Hotel.

Day 8 | Across the Alps to Lucerne

Drive via the scenic Italian Lakes District, across the

Alps into beautiful Switzerland, where we’ll spend the

next two nights in the medieval lakeside city of

Lucerne. View the mournful, mortally wounded lion

hewn from rock to commemorate the Swiss Guards

who lost their lives defending Louis XVI. Walk along the

flower-lined 14 -century covered Chapel Bridge,

crossing the river Reuss.

Overnight Stay at Hotel.
